git笔记02

2019-12-22  本文已影响0人  金华两头乌

比对分支

git diff HEAD HEAD^
git diff HEAD b342771c752f4
git diff 702396b0d1 b342771c75

删除分支

git branch -d fix-01

创建分支

git checkout -b fix_readme fix-01

修改最新commit的message

git commit --amend

修改老旧commit的message(702396b0d1为被修改commit的父亲)

git rebase -i 702396b0d1

连续的commit整理成一个

1576984015513.jpg
899.jpg

间隔的commit整理成一个

8474.jpg

查看HEAD和暂存区的差异

dongsihengdeMBP:git_objects dsh$ git diff --cached
diff --git a/readme b/readme
index 2d832d9..979b204 100644
--- a/readme
+++ b/readme
@@ -1 +1 @@
-hello,world
+dsh,ello,world

查看工作区和暂存区的差异

git diff
git diff -- readme.md

上一篇 下一篇

猜你喜欢

热点阅读